编程可以做什么玩具呢视频教学
-
编程是一门非常有趣和实用的技能,通过编程,我们可以制作各种各样的玩具。下面,我将为你介绍几个可以用编程制作的玩具,并给出相关的视频教学。
-
机器人玩具:编程可以让你制作自己的机器人玩具,通过编写代码,控制机器人的动作、声音和互动。你可以使用Arduino、树莓派等硬件平台,结合传感器和执行器,制作一个能够走动、说话、识别颜色等功能的机器人。以下是一个制作Arduino机器人的视频教学:https://www.youtube.com/watch?v=8c6iJ8uq9qQ
-
游戏控制器:你可以使用编程语言如Python或Unity等,制作自己的游戏控制器。通过编写代码,将按钮、摇杆等硬件设备与游戏进行交互。你可以制作一个模拟驾驶的方向盘、体感游戏的运动控制器等。以下是一个使用Python制作游戏控制器的视频教学:https://www.youtube.com/watch?v=RL8d-x5zN1c
-
交互式艺术装置:编程可以帮助你制作具有交互性的艺术装置。通过编写代码,你可以让装置对触摸、声音、光线等环境变化做出响应,创造出独特的艺术效果。以下是一个制作交互式艺术装置的视频教学:https://www.youtube.com/watch?v=4OaHB0JbJDI
-
音乐创作工具:编程可以让你制作自己的音乐创作工具。你可以使用编程语言如Pure Data或Sonic Pi,通过编写代码生成各种音乐效果,包括合成器、音乐律动等。以下是一个使用Pure Data制作音乐创作工具的视频教学:https://www.youtube.com/watch?v=3tL7Bp3p6Ck
以上是一些可以用编程制作的玩具的示例,你可以根据自己的兴趣和编程能力选择适合的项目进行学习和实践。希望这些视频教学对你有所帮助!
1年前 -
-
编程是一种创造性的活动,可以用来制作各种各样的玩具。以下是几个可以用编程制作的玩具的例子:
-
电子音乐乐器:使用编程语言如Python或JavaScript,可以编写代码来控制音乐合成器或其他音乐设备,创造出自己的音乐作品。
-
机器人:利用编程语言如Arduino或Raspberry Pi,可以编写代码来控制机器人的运动和行为。通过编程,可以让机器人做各种有趣的事情,如跳舞、画画或解决迷题。
-
游戏:编程是制作电子游戏的关键技能。使用游戏引擎如Unity或Unreal Engine,可以编写代码来创建自己的游戏角色、场景和游戏规则。
-
LED灯艺术:通过编程控制LED灯的亮灭和颜色,可以创造出各种华丽的灯光艺术效果,如彩虹灯带、跳动的音乐灯等。
-
交互式艺术装置:通过编程和传感器技术,可以制作出具有互动性的艺术装置。比如,通过编程来控制摄像头和投影仪,可以创造出根据观众动作变化的交互式投影艺术作品。
以上只是一些编程玩具的例子,实际上编程的应用远远不止这些。通过学习编程,可以开发出更多有趣的玩具,激发创造力和想象力,培养解决问题的能力。同时,编程也是一项重要的技能,未来在科技行业中有很大的就业潜力。
1年前 -
-
编程可以制作各种有趣的玩具。以下是一些可以用编程制作的玩具的示例,以及如何使用视频教学来教授这些玩具的制作过程。
-
电子游戏:
编程可以用来制作各种类型的电子游戏,如平台游戏、射击游戏、益智游戏等。通过视频教学,可以教授学生如何使用编程语言(如Python、Java、C++)来创建游戏的基本元素,如角色、关卡、碰撞检测等。视频教学可以展示编程代码的编写过程,并演示游戏的运行效果。 -
机器人:
编程可以用来控制机器人的动作和行为。通过视频教学,可以教授学生如何使用编程语言(如C、Python、Arduino)来编写控制机器人的代码,包括移动、感应、音频等功能。视频教学可以展示编程代码的编写过程,并演示机器人的实际操作。 -
3D打印模型:
编程可以用来设计和打印3D模型。通过视频教学,可以教授学生如何使用建模软件(如Tinkercad、Fusion 360)来设计3D模型,并使用编程语言(如Python、OpenSCAD)来生成和修改模型。视频教学可以展示建模软件的使用方法,并演示3D打印的过程。 -
交互式艺术装置:
编程可以用来创建交互式艺术装置,如光电装置、声音装置等。通过视频教学,可以教授学生如何使用编程语言(如Processing、Max/MSP)来编写控制装置的代码,包括传感器的读取、音频的处理、输出设备的控制等。视频教学可以展示编程代码的编写过程,并演示艺术装置的交互效果。 -
机器学习模型:
编程可以用来创建机器学习模型,如图像识别、语音识别等。通过视频教学,可以教授学生如何使用机器学习库(如TensorFlow、PyTorch)来训练和使用模型,包括数据的准备、模型的搭建、训练和测试的过程。视频教学可以展示代码的编写过程,并演示模型的预测效果。
在视频教学中,可以按照以下结构组织内容:
-
引言:介绍编程玩具的概念和意义,激发学生的兴趣。
-
简介:介绍所要制作的玩具的基本原理和功能。
-
工具准备:介绍所需要的软件和硬件工具,并提供下载和安装的指导。
-
编程语言介绍:简要介绍所使用的编程语言,包括语法和特点。
-
代码编写:逐步讲解代码的编写过程,包括关键函数和参数的使用。
-
调试和测试:介绍调试代码的方法和常见问题的解决办法,并演示玩具的运行效果。
-
扩展和创新:鼓励学生在基础玩具的基础上进行创新和扩展,提供一些拓展思路和示例。
-
结语:总结制作过程,鼓励学生继续探索编程玩具的世界。
通过视频教学,学生可以在观看和模仿的过程中学习编程的基本知识和技能,同时也可以激发他们的创造力和创新思维。
1年前 -